Legislation - Signed (Executive) - Became Public Law No. 108-83 - Sept. 30, 2003
Legislation - Conference Report Adopted (House) (371-56) - Sept. 24, 2003 (Key vote)
Title: Emergency Supplemental Appropriation, FY 2003 bill
Vote to adopt a conference report that would appropriate $3.5 billion for the Legislative Branch operations for Fiscal Year 2004.
- Funds the hiring of 75 new Capitol Police officers.
- Provides $13.5 million to the Open World Program to teach the principles of democracy to Russian leaders.
- Authorizes around $937 million for Fiscal Year 2003 in supplemental funds to be used for emergency disaster relief.
- Includes $47.8 million for continued work on the Capitol Visitor's Center.
